Key Components of a Comprehensive First Aid Incident Report Form Template

Let’s examine the essential sections typically included in a First Aid Incident Report Form Template. Each section is designed to gather specific information crucial for investigation and analysis.

Image 4 for First Aid Incident Report Form Template

Section 1: Incident Details

This section serves as the foundational record of the event. It requires detailed information about the incident itself, including:

  • Date and Time of Incident: Precisely record the date and time the incident occurred.
  • Location of Incident: Specify the exact location where the incident took place.
  • Description of Incident: Provide a clear and concise narrative of what happened. Avoid jargon and focus on observable events. For example, “A worker tripped and fell, sustaining a minor ankle injury.”
  • Witness Statements: Include contact information for any witnesses to the incident. Record their names, contact details, and a brief summary of their observations.
  • Equipment Involved: List all equipment used during the incident, including model numbers and any relevant maintenance records.

Section 2: Injuries and Medical Assessment

This section focuses on the injuries sustained by individuals involved. It’s crucial to document the nature, severity, and treatment of any injuries.

  • Injuries Reported: Detail all reported injuries, including the type of injury, location, and any associated symptoms.
  • Medical Assessment: Record the initial medical assessment provided by first responders. Note any treatment administered, medications given, and the patient’s condition.
  • Medical Treatment Provided: Document the specific treatments received, including medications, therapies, and any follow-up care.
  • First Aid Personnel: Identify the first aid personnel involved in the assessment and treatment.

Section 3: Contributing Factors

This section explores potential contributing factors to the incident. Analyzing these factors can help identify systemic issues and prevent future occurrences.

  • Equipment Malfunction: Assess whether any equipment malfunction contributed to the incident.
  • Lack of Training: Evaluate whether inadequate training or procedures contributed to the event.
  • Environmental Factors: Consider any environmental factors that may have played a role, such as slippery surfaces or inadequate lighting.
  • Human Error: Identify any potential human error that may have contributed to the incident.
  • Communication Breakdown: Assess whether communication between personnel involved was effective.

Section 4: Corrective Actions & Preventative Measures

This section outlines the steps taken to address the incident and prevent similar events from occurring in the future.

  • Corrective Actions Taken: Describe the actions taken to mitigate the impact of the incident.
  • Preventative Measures Implemented: Outline the preventative measures that have been implemented to address the contributing factors.
  • Training Updates: Document any training updates or refresher courses that have been completed.
  • Equipment Maintenance: Record any maintenance activities performed on equipment.

Section 5: Appendices (Optional)

This section may include supplementary information, such as photographs, videos, or detailed medical records.

  • Photographic Evidence: Include photographs of the incident scene, injuries, and equipment.
  • Video Recordings: Record video footage of the incident.
  • Medical Records: Attach relevant medical records.
